What is M/Flex?
Worried about familiarity with M/Flex? No problem. We’ll take care of training you on everything you need to know to run a successful class. M/Flex consists of 2, 10 minute yoga sessions - one at the beginning of class to warm athletes up, and one at the end to cool them down. The middle part of class is made of 20 minutes of a pre-programmed H.I.I.T. style workout. In this middle section, athletes will use anything from their own bodyweight, to dumbbells, kettlebells, slam balls, pull up bars, and a number of other pieces of equipment. Students can expect to get conditioned, stronger, and more flexible all in one class.
